Term Insurance
A type of life insurance policy that provides coverage for a specific period of time, or term, offering a death benefit to beneficiaries if the insured passes away during the term.
Whole Life Insurance
A type of life insurance policy that offers coverage for the insured's entire lifetime, typically including a savings component.
